摘要: 针对伊犁新垦区淡灰钙土土壤肥力不高的特点,设计了4种土壤熟化处理措施(无施肥,CK;施氮磷钾肥,NPK;施氮磷钾+糠醛渣,NPKK;施氮磷钾+秸秆还田,NPKJ),进行3 a定点试验。应用模糊数学(Fuzzy)综合评判法,计算不同熟化处理下土壤的综合肥力指数(IFI)。在不同熟化方式下,对比分析单项土壤肥力指标与综合肥力指数以及作物产量。结果表明:增施有机物对土壤养分含量均有提高,同时还可以有效降低土壤pH和土壤容重,其中以增施糠醛渣效果最明显;综合肥力评价表明,施氮磷钾+糠醛渣的土壤肥力综合指数最高,达0.826,施氮磷钾+秸秆还田高于单施氮磷钾肥或不施肥;增施有机物是提高土壤综合肥力的有效方法,但有机物中养分的释放存在一定延后性。

Abstract: n order to improve soil fertility of the newly reclaimed light sierozem in Ili,Xinjiang,five different fertilizing measures were taken and compared during a 3-year period.The fuzzy method was used as an integrated evaluation to calculate the values of integrated fertility index [WTBX](IFI).[WTBZ] The values of fertility index,IFI and crop yield under different fertilizing measures were compared.The results showed that soil fertility could be improved by applying organic fertilizer,especially by applying furfural residue,and soil pH value and soil volume weight could be reduced.The assessed results revealed that the value of IFI was the highest (0.826) when nitrogenous fertilizer,phosphatic fertilizer and potash fertilizer were applied with furfural residue,which revealed that this fertilizing measure was optimal to improve soil fertility.Application of organic material is an effective way of improving soil fertility,but the release of nutritive substance from organic material is relative slow.
